Which of the following travellers was/were associated
with the Vijayanagara empire? 1. Ibn Battuta 2. Marco Polo 3. Nicolo de Conti 4. Domingo Paes Select the correct answer from the codes given below.Solution
Ibn Battuta (1) visited India during the reign of Muhammad bin Tughlaq and although he did not visit the Vijayanagara Empire directly, his travels took place during the broader period when the empire was in existence. Marco Polo (2) visited India before the establishment of the Vijayanagara Empire, so he was not associated with it. Nicolo de Conti (3) visited the Vijayanagara Empire and provided an account of his experiences. Domingo Paes (4) was a Portuguese traveler who visited the Vijayanagara Empire and wrote detailed accounts of it.
